A NEEDLEWORK-COVERED AND GILT-WOOD SEDAN CHAIR
LATE 18TH CENTURY, PROBABLY FRENCH
Covered overall back and front with English 18th century floral meander needlework on ivory ground, the inside lined with original Spitalfields style silk brocade, with arched roof and glazed sides with door opening to the front, removable side carrying bars
76 ¼ in. (194 cm.) high; 27 in. (69 cm.) x 28 ¼ in. (72 cm.)
